## Deployment

The Haulmark fuel-usage report runs nightly as a scheduled job on the Ridgeline cluster. It aggregates odometer and pump records from the previous day, so deploy only after the ingestion window closes at 02:00 local. As a new contractor, please deploy to the sandbox tier first. The job reads the configuration shown below.

config for kafof-bawef:
holath:
  log_level: debug
  metrics_host: metrics.holath.qorvelsys.internal
  pin: 2191
  pool_size: 32

## Service Accounts — StormFan Alert Fan-Out

The fan-out worker authenticates to the internal dispatch tier using the svc-stormfan account. Rotate quarterly; scopes are limited to publish-only on alert topics. If deliveries stall during your shift, verify the worker is using the current credential, reproduced below for reference.

API key for kaweg-hahif: kto4_rAjZ

Ticket: Digest scheduler change — needs security sign-off

Hey, we're moving the Plumeline batch email digests from a fixed 02:00 cron to a per-tenant sliding window. This touches the job queue's auth token scope (read access to recipient lists gets broader for the scheduler worker), so it needs a security review before we merge. Nothing scary, but the scope bump is real and worth eyes. Rollback plan is in the ticket comments. The engineer responsible for the change is listed below.

named custodian: Oliath Ralax

**Mgmt Meeting Minutes — Retiring the Brightline Range**

Quick recap for sales leads at Fenholt Supplies: we agreed to retire the Brightline fixture range by year-end. Remaining stock moves to clearance pricing next month, and accounts on standing orders get migrated to the Lumetta range. Trade-in incentives were approved in principle. The confidential note on next steps sits just below.

board note of bajof-bajeg: The pricing group signed off on a budget of $13.4 million for Project Sildor. The renewal with Lamixek Holdings closes at $48.9 million a year, 49 percent above the last contract.